Pixar's Tribute to Cinema

You may have noticed that Pixar storytellers and animators are movie lovers, and often slip references to classic films into their movies. But you probably haven’t caught how often it happens. Recent film school graduate Jorge Luengo Ruiz of Madrid noticed, and put those references together to show us.

You'll see callbacks to classic movies in Toy Story to Finding Nemo to The Incredibles and more. Ruiz mentioned that he left out A Bug’s Life because the whole movie is “is a tribute to Kurosawa's Seven Samurai.”  Besides Kurosawa, Pixar seems to have a undying admiration for Stanley Kubrick and Alfred Hitchcock. -via Buzzfeed
